San Francisco District Attorney Lobbies Governor Cuomo To Commute His Father’s Sentence - A Commentary And Request for Signatures By Rockland County Legislator James Foley


The New York Post reported on February 19, 2021 that the San Francisco district attorney — whose father helped kill two cops and a guard in the infamous Brink’s armored car robbery in Nyack, New York, in 1981 — is lobbying Governor Andrew Cuomo to commute his dad’s sentence.

 

https://nypost.com/2021/02/19/son-of-brinks-truck-robbers-wants-cuomo-to-commute-dads-sentence/

 

Chesa Boudin, was 14 months old when his parents, David Gilbert and Kathy Boudin, members of the domestic terror group Weather Underground, dropped him off at a baby-sitter and then helped pull off the heinous heist in Nanuet, Rockland County which resulted in three deaths.

 

Two Nyack policemen, Sgt. Edward O’Grady and Officer Waverly Brown — as well as Brink’s guard Peter Paige — were killed in the robbery and the ensuing shootout at a nearby roadblock.

 

While we have the greatest sympathy for Chesa Boudin’s loss of his father’s presence in his life and while we recognize that forgiveness of those who repent is to be granted, we must not forgive the heinous nature of the crime that was committed nor can we withdraw the penalty that was imposed.

 

I oppose all efforts to have David Gilbert’s sentence commuted by Governor Cuomo. Without the intervention of a New York State governor, Gilbert will not be eligible for parole until 2056. My belief is that Gilbert should remain in prison at this time.


I sympathize with District Attorney Chesa Boudin in that he was only14 months of age when his parents chose to leave him with a baby sitter while they went to commit an act of murderous terrorism. He is indeed yet one more victim of the act committed by his parents on that dreadful day.


Our sympathy, however, does not extend to the man who consciously decided to assist others in taking up arms against his own country by participating in a robbery that brought fully automatic weapons to bear against those who were sworn to serve and protect the citizens of Rockland County.

 

Our sympathy is further restrained by the fact that during his trial Gilbert managed to insult and emotionally injure this community beyond the actions for which he was tried. We note that he took as his legal position that he did not recognize the authority of the United States and claimed it had no right to put him on trial.

 

Our sympathy is additionally restrained by actions on the rendering of the jury’s verdict. Gilbert stayed in the basement of the courthouse, railing against the United States, and refused to appear in court and face his victims’ grieving relatives.

 

The sins of the father do not pass to the children and we are encouraged by the knowledge that DA Boudin is probably a better district attorney given his own personal family history and his personal knowledge of the pain of a life of incarceration.


However, it is our belief the power that comes from the office of San Francisco DA should not be used to lobby on behalf of one’s own family member. This is a misguided use of a DA’s power and could be interpreted as a further insult to the family of the victims of this act, Nyack policemen, Sgt. Edward O’Grady, Officer Waverly Brown, and Brink’s guard Peter Paige.


As a Rockland County Legislator representing part of The Nyacks who was a ninth grader when this event occurred close to my home in Rockland County, I can attest from first hand experience of this community that we are still processing the loss and trauma from that day. We are still trying to make sense of what Gilbert did.


Our pain and loss remain, as does that for DA Boudin. David Gilbert ought to remain imprisioned.
